We had a wonderful stay at Seda Club Hotel Granada. From the moment I arrived, the service stood out — Laura and Chillia (sorry I forgot the pronouncation) at reception were warm, welcoming, and very professional both check in and check out. The bar and breakfast team made our visit a pleasure, and the gentleman who helped with my luggage was equally attentive and professional. The hotel itself is beautifully designed, with a stunning interior that feels both stylish and comfortable. Amenities are thoughtfully provided and of excellent quality, adding to the overall experience. I also have to mention that they make an outstanding Negroni at the bar — definitely one of the best I’ve had! Please do check out their stairs. Overall, Seda Club Hotel Granada combines top-notch service with elegant design and great hospitality. Highly recommended.

Honestly, we'd never stayed in a hotel quite like this before; we really liked how 'modern' it was. The bathroom had the typical Japanese toilet with water jets, and the sink had a pressure and temperature regulator for the water. Plus, the shower offered two types of shampoo: one vegan and one anti-dandruff/anti-hair loss, two types of shower gel: one for sensitive skin and a melon-scented one, and a conditioner. In the room, there's a large Smart TV, white LED lights, and warm overhead lighting. What's more, the hotel has a gaming area, as shown in the photos, with a PS1 arcade for a touch of nostalgia, a PS5, two gaming-style computers, and a racing wheel setup for games that require it (though we didn't really check out what games they had). It's great for those traveling with kids or anyone who wants to enjoy it while visiting Granada. We absolutely loved the hotel, both for its cleanliness and its modern amenities.
